We can't tell you who your admins are either - it's your system, not ours.  In some setups, there's a "contact administrators" at the bottom which is worth a try, but if that's not available, you'll need to ask your colleagues who owns it.  Perhaps raise an issue in a support project/service-desk if there is one (we always recommend having a support project for Atlassian systems)

When you work out who the admins of your system are, we'll be able to talk them through the problem, but get them to start with my answer below.

The obvious answer is that you need to click on a transition out of the current status.

But, you need to check that

  1. There is a transition
  2. You have the permissions to use it

Have a look at the "workflow diagram" (most people set up JIRA so that users have the option to view it next to the status on the issue view).  Does that show any outgoing transitions?

If it does not, then your workflow does not allow it.  Given the name of the status, I doubt that is the case, so the next step is to log in as an administrator and go look at the workflow in the admin screens.  Find the workflow in use (check the workflow scheme for the project), open it up and look at the transition(s) leaving that status, checking specifically the "conditions".  You will find that your account, or something on the issue, is blocking the transition. 

Two other things though.  You  should check also that you have the permission "transition" in the permission scheme (I very much doubt this is the problem, as it would block you from using all transitions).  And then, if all the conditions are ok and you can't find anything else wrong, then there's a known issue in JIRA where data gets corrupt and the symptom is "can't transition an issue" - run the integrity checker functions for workflows to see if that is the problem here.
